  3. Rafferty's Rules is an Australian television drama series which ran from 1987 to 1991 on the Seven Network. The producers of the series were Posie Graeme-Evans (1987–1988), and Denis Phelen. The directors were Graham Thorburn, Mike Smith and Russell Webb. The writers were David Allen, John Upton, Tim Gooding and David Marsh.

  5. Truth to Tell. Episode 1.3. Thu, February 26, 1987. W: Bruce Stewart. D: Leigh Spence. Rafferty presides over a case that sees a self-proclaimed white witch defending herself against a fraud charge for providing a faulty love potion. While prosecuting the case, Flicker is struck down by a mysterious illness — or perhaps a curse.
